SBI Clerk, also called Junior Associate recruitment in SBI notifications, is a popular banking exam route for graduates. This guide explains eligibility, prelims, mains, local language requirement, documents, official SBI Careers checks and preparation strategy.

SBI Clerk Eligibility Checks

  • Graduation or equivalent qualification as per official notice.
  • Age limit and relaxation rules.
  • State/UT selection and local language requirement.
  • Category, EWS, PwBD or ex-servicemen documents if applicable.
  • Correct personal details matching certificates.

SBI Clerk Syllabus Areas

Numerical Ability

Simplification, arithmetic, number series, DI basics and speed calculation.

Reasoning

Puzzles, seating, syllogism, inequality, coding, direction and alphanumeric series.

English

Reading comprehension, grammar, cloze test, error spotting and vocabulary.

General Awareness

Banking awareness, current affairs, economy basics and SBI-related public information.

Documents Required

Keep photo, signature, ID proof, graduation certificate, category/EWS/PwBD certificate if applicable, application form, payment receipt and local-language-related documents if required by the notification.
